As some of you know, I am losing my job at the end of July after 17 years of service. The company has been nice enough to give me a nice severance package, so what am I going to do? GO FISHING!! Planning a trip the first or second week of August which I will leave from Indiana, spend the night catfishing with a guide (Warren Byrd) in Tennessee on the Cumberland River, and then from there going to head down to Doug's Creek House for about 4 days or so, and then leave there and fish the James River in Richmond or 3 or 4 days. This is going to be the catfish trip of a lifetime!! I cant wait. If anyone can hook me up with a boat or boat rental on the James, I would be most appreciative.  Any thoughts or suggestions will be welcomed.
